  2. Resource allocation: whether resource of a carrier could be allocated by control signals of its own carrier, or by control signals of other carriers. Support single MAC or multiple MAC. C80216m-08_026r2 Open issues of multi-carrier framework

  3. Support single MAC to provide load balancing and scheduling enhancements. The common message of one DL carrier can allocate resource of other DL carriers and UL carriers. Support MS Based Primary Carrier concept. It means that MS only receives its control signal and resource assignment message from its Primary Carrier. C80216m-08_026r2 Suggest solution

  6. The Broadcast Channel of each carrier is independent. Even an MS that is capable of demodulating all carriers shall access the system on only one carrier. When MS finishes the process of network entry and BS knows its capability, it can start scheduling the MS on multiple carries. When an MS enters idle mode, it will only listen on one carrier. C80216m-08_026r2 Specific feature
